Transaction 8971143e8a39eaf709a17ca09ff9f856fd196d899ee95f16d3c11f2151964b20
1 Input
1 Output
-
8971143e8a39eaf709a17ca09ff9f856fd196d899ee95f16d3c11f2151964b20:0
- value
- 58444401
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e1dd062abd47b9d12885d6de4e8e485d227616c
- address
- bc1qlcwaqc4t63ae6y5gt4k7f68yshfzwctvuw65yv